Cost of hiring an attorney for an auto accident

Although it may be expensive to hire a car accident lawyer, it's an investment that is worthwhile in the long run. This type of best attorney for car accident near me will reduce stress and time by taking care of the legal aspects of your car accident. A car accident lawyer will charge you a one-time fee or they might charge by the hour.

The majority of car accident lawyers charge a portion of the compensation they collect, ranging from 25 percent to 40%. The higher fees are necessary for more complicated cases. If the case is settled quickly, however you'll likely pay a lower percentage. However, it is important to read the contract.

Another option for payment is a contingency fee arrangement. This type of arrangement is ideal for small claims and does not require upfront payments. It allows you to make installments over a period of time, rather than having to pay in full. But, be aware of the fine print and make sure that the lawyer for your car accident will not charge you more than what is needed.

It's typically less expensive to hire an auto accident lawyer than people think. The majority of attorneys work on a contingency basis which means that they get a percentage of the settlement they receive on behalf of their clients. The percentage is contingent upon the nature of the case, the state law, and the legal market in the region. A general rule of thumb is 33% for the final settlement.

Although PIP insurance is a viable option to cover basic economic losses it's usually quite limited. It covers medical expenses as well as some lost wages. The maximum amount is usually less than $50,000. If you earn more you might be able to claim more.

If another driver caused the accident, you may be eligible for compensation. You should remember that the accident was caused in part by multiple drivers, and each driver could be held accountable for a percentage.
